PM Modi at BIMSTEC Summit: 'Work with full enthusiasm' | ABP News
In the midst of the ongoing Russia-Ukraine conflict, Prime Minister Narendra Modi spoke at the 5th BIMSTEC Summit on Wednesday (March 30, 2022), saying that recent events in Europe have "raised worries about the stability of world order." Prime Minister Modi remarked that the time has come to make the Bay of Bengal the bridge of connection, prosperity, and security during the virtual summit, which is being hosted by Sri Lanka, the current BIMSTEC chair.
